Latest Patents

Janice Main holds one patent titled "Methods of predicting the outcome of HBV infection." This patent provides methods and kits to predict the outcomes of HBV infections. Specifically, it includes techniques that involve determining the presence of mutations in exon 1 of the gene coding for the human MBP gene. This breakthrough has the potential to enhance understanding of HBV-related complications.
